Our client, a prominent leader in technology solutions, is seeking a Partner Account Manager to oversee two of their most significant partnerships.
Key Responsibilities:- Serve as the primary point of contact for two key accounts / Vendors.
- Sales enabler assisting the sales team with these vendors.
- Manage the pipeline with your vendors.
- Facilitate communication between partners and resellers.
- Proactively manage marketing, product management, and distribution support for partners.
- Oversee partner programs to ensure alignment and effectiveness.
- Previous experience in Sales is an advantage.
- Sales Enablement is a plus.
- Skilled in collaborating with sales teams to clearly communicate services, products, and offers.
- Capable of leading initiatives with resellers and end clients.
- Passionate about technology and innovation.
- Experienced in working with senior management, agencies, clients, and partners.
- Proficient in managing multiple projects simultaneously.

How to prepare for a job interview at ice recruitment
✨Know Your Sales Methodologies
Brush up on popular sales methodologies like SPIN Selling or Challenger Sales. Being able to discuss these techniques and how you've applied them will show ice recruitment that you understand the role and can hit the ground running in the sales game.
✨Demonstrate Your Deal-Making Skills
Prepare to share stories from your past experiences where you closed deals, overcame objections, or started new client relationships. We want to show ice recruitment that you’re not just about numbers but also about building lasting connections in business development.
✨Prepare for Role-Play Scenarios
In a full-time sales interview, don’t be surprised if they throw in a role-play exercise to test your pitching skills. Practising how you would pitch a product or handle an objection will help us shine in this simulation—think of it like a dress rehearsal for your future sales calls!
